Application of the sulphide capacity theory on refining slags during LF treatment

Abstract: Sulphur has been reduced from 0.02wt% to 0.002wt% in 38 min average during 200 t ladle treatment in 2# steel plant of Capital Steel. The sulphide capacity and equilibrium sulphur distribution of slags are calculated and compared with the measured values. The results show that the KTH model is a useful tool for the prediction of sulphide capacity and sulphur distribution during ladle treatment; the desulphurization reactions are completed nearly in thermo-equilibrium.
